Understanding the Basics of Bookkeeping
Bookkeeping serves as the backbone of financial organization, providing a systematic method for recording and managing a business’s financial transactions.
Accurate financial records are essential for effective expense tracking, enabling businesses to monitor cash flow and identify areas for cost reduction.
Establishing a Consistent Bookkeeping System
A consistent bookkeeping system is vital for maintaining organized financial records and ensuring that a business can efficiently manage its operations.
Establishing routines for regular entries and reviews facilitates accurate tracking of expenses, allowing for timely decision-making.
Utilizing Technology to Enhance Financial Organization
While traditional methods of financial organization have served many businesses well, the integration of technology has transformed the landscape of bookkeeping and financial management.
Utilizing cloud software and mobile apps allows businesses to streamline processes, access real-time data, and enhance collaboration.
This technological advancement not only increases efficiency but also empowers individuals to maintain greater control over their financial organization, fostering a sense of freedom.
Regularly Reviewing and Analyzing Your Financial Data
Regularly reviewing and analyzing financial data is essential for informed decision-making within any organization.
This practice enables the identification of financial trends and ensures data accuracy, fostering a culture of transparency and accountability.
